white / black is the perm pos feed from battery

postion 1 no circuit (every thing switched off) black / white would be live if connected to battery

postion 2 (auxilary) white / red out to any auxilary circuit you want to put in ie. radio

postion 3 (run) white / blue provides the switched positive for the marlin fusebox and the switched pos to the engine management. The white / red remains live to feed the auxilary circuit

postion 3 (crank) use white as output (that matches the marlin loom and use one of the remaining wires to connect to the battery perm pos feed. I think this right but i will check my crank circuit diagrams because i am preety sure the white connects to the engine management for crank
but the other two seem strange black being the major colour would suggest earth not live.
